What Is an Online Ads Platform?
Definition and Core Functions
An Online Ads Platform is a digital service that allows businesses to display advertisements across various online channels. These platforms serve as intermediaries between advertisers and publishers, streamlining the process of buying and selling ad inventory. They offer a suite of tools that facilitate the creation, targeting, and performance analysis of ad campaigns. By automating these processes, online ad platforms help advertisers reach a broader audience while optimizing spending and maximizing return on investment (ROI).
Key Features of Online Ads Platforms
- Campaign Management: Tools to create, schedule, and monitor ad campaigns.
- Targeting Capabilities: Options to target audiences based on demographics, interests, geographic locations, and behavioral data.
- Real-time Analytics: Performance dashboards that provide insights on ad impressions, clicks, conversions, and overall ROI.
- Budget Optimization: Features that help allocate budgets effectively across multiple campaigns or channels.
- Multiple Ad Formats: Support for various formats such as display ads, search ads, video ads, native ads, and more.

The Evolution of Digital Advertising Platforms
A Shift from Traditional to Digital
The advertising industry has witnessed a dramatic shift from traditional media such as television, radio, and print to digital channels. This transition is largely driven by the increasing amount of time consumers spend online and the availability of advanced tracking and targeting technologies. Digital advertising platforms have become essential for brands looking to reach a tech-savvy audience that is constantly connected to the internet.
Integration of AI and Machine Learning
One of the most exciting developments in digital advertising is the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ning. These technologies enable online ads platforms to analyze vast amounts of data, predict consumer behavior, and optimize campaigns in real time. By leveraging AI-driven insights, advertisers can create more effective ads, adjust bids dynamically, and enhance overall campaign performance.
Rise of Mobile and Multi-Channel Strategies
The rapid proliferation of smartphones and tablets has transformed how consumers access digital content. As a result, mobile advertising has become a critical component of any digital marketing strategy. Modern online ad platforms support multi-channel strategies that encompass mobile, desktop, social media, and even emerging platforms like connected TV. This multi-channel approach ensures that businesses can reach their audience regardless of the device or platform they are using.

Microsoft Advertising (Bing Ads)
Overview
Microsoft Advertising, formerly known as Bing Ads, provides an alternative to Google Ads, offering lower competition and often more affordable costs per click. It is particularly appealing to businesses looking to tap into a different segment of the search market.
Key Features
- Cost-effective bidding: typically lower cost-per-click compared to Google Ads.
- Audience Targeting: Access to a unique demographic that may not be as saturated.
- Seamless Integration: Compatibility with various Microsoft products and services.
- User-Friendly Interface: Simplified campaign management tools ideal for beginners.
Pros
- Lower Costs: Often more budget-friendly, making it attractive for small businesses.
- Untapped Market: Reached audiences that may not be active on Google.
- Simple Setup: Easy-to-use interface and management tools.
Cons
- Smaller Reach: Limited compared to the vast audience of Google Ads.
- Less Advanced Features: Fewer advanced targeting and optimization tools.
- Market Share: Lower overall market share can impact campaign volume.
AdRoll
Overview
AdRoll is a versatile digital advertising platform that specializes in retargeting. It helps businesses reconnect with website visitors who did not convert on their first visit, offering a powerful solution to increase conversions and drive sales.
Key Features
- Retargeting Focus: Specialized in re-engaging lost prospects through dynamic ads.
- Cross-Channel Campaigns: Reach users across the web, social media, and email.
- Data-Driven Insights: Advanced analytics to refine retargeting strategies.
- Personalized Ad Experiences: customizable ad content based on user behavior.
Pros
- Effective Retargeting: Proven to boost conversion rates by re-engaging potential customers.
- Omni-Channel Approach: Integrates multiple channels for cohesive campaigns.
- User-Friendly Dashboard: A simplified interface for managing complex campaigns.
Cons
- Higher Costs: Retargeting campaigns can be more expensive due to the competitive nature of re-engagement.
- Steep Learning Curve: requires a solid understanding of retargeting strategies.
- Niche Focus: May not be the best fit for businesses not heavily reliant on retargeting.

How does PPC advertising work?
Ans: PPC advertising (pay-per-click advertising) is a model where advertisers pay only when a user clicks on their ad. This ensures that your advertising budget is used efficiently, as you’re only charged for actual engagement.
